Brant Sherman's sharpshooting skills have led him to his job as a federal marshal. His big mouth has kept him from advancing beyond the rank of deputy. Following a high profile prisoner transfer debacle Sherman is moved to his home town of Concord, Mass. and a case that has been kept under wraps due to animal rights issues¿a tinderbox for the media. His boss considers him a predator and who better to stalk the killers? But as two very different women vie for his attention, the harrowing attacks begin to escalate, the predator/prey relationship starts to change and Brant must ask himself what his own place in the terrible chain of events might be. "Robbins' debut starts out with a bang and never lets up. With a terrific New England setting and an insider's perspective, The Coffin Blind combines non-step outdoor action, horrific violence, smartass humor, some surprisingly touching moments, and an engaging protagonist in a pedal-to-the-metal and joyfully non-PC crime novel. I think we'll be seeing more of Mark Robbins and Brant Sherman. At least I hope so..." C.J. Box, New York Times bestselling author of Blue Heaven and Blood Trail.
